Role Summary
This role is pivotal in driving alignment and supporting strategic and operational initiatives within the Service Parts team. You will collaborate closely with Demand Planning, Material Planning, Channel Planning, Global Strategy, and Global Distribution leaders to ensure cost-effective end-to-end supply chain strategies that maximize uptime and enhance customer service.
Responsibilities
- Strategic Partnership:
- Partner with functional leadership to provide strategic insights and support decision-making.
- Develop and execute cross-functional strategic plans aligned with company goals.
- Act as the service parts liaison for special projects and voice of customer initiatives.
- Integrate sales and operations processes with key business partners.
- Conduct quarterly business reviews with stakeholders.
- Operational Excellence:
- Drive process improvement, standardization, and innovation within the supply network through supply chain domain knowledge
- Lead change management initiatives for new processes, technologies, and organizational structures.
- Optimize meeting effectiveness through clear agendas, quality content, and actionable follow-ups.
- Develop and track KPIs to measure team and project success.
- Collaborate with accounting on excess and obsolescence forecasting and execution.
- Communication & Collaboration:
- Facilitate clear communication between leadership, teams, and stakeholders via structured plans (newsletters, meetings, announcements).
- Manage program risks and issues, implementing corrective actions with partners.
- Lead staff meetings and workshops for focused discussions.
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in a supply chain related field
- 5+ years of experience in strategic roles within tech, automotive, or related industries, with a track record of increasing responsibility
- 3+ years of project or program management experience
- 2+ years of experience driving clear and consistent communications across business units
Preferred
- Demonstrated ability to think strategically and translate complex concepts into actionable plans
- Strong leadership acumen, with experience managing cross-functional stakeholders and influencing at all levels of an organization
- Excellent interpersonal skills, with the ability to build high-trust relationships and navigate complex organizational dynamics
- Bias for action; a propensity to drive items to closure without sacrificing quality or timeliness
- Adaptability and resilience in the face of rapid change and ambiguity
